The Benefits of Exfoliation

Exfoliation offers numerous benefits that go beyond just removing dead skin cells. Here are some of the key advantages:.

1. Removes Dead Skin Cells

When dead skin cells accumulate on the surface, they can make your skin appear dull and lackluster. Regular exfoliation helps get rid of these dead cells, revealing a smoother and brighter complexion.

2. Enhances Skin Cell Turnover

Exfoliation stimulates the production of new skin cells, which leads to a faster skin cell turnover. This revitalizes your skin, giving it a youthful and healthy appearance.

3. Reduces the Appearance of Fine Lines and Wrinkles

The build-up of dead skin cells can accentuate the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les. Exfoliating regularly helps smoothen these lines and minimize their visibility, contributing to a more youthful look.

4. Prevents Breakouts and Acne

By removing dead skin cells, exfoliation helps unclog pores, preventing the formation of acne and breakouts. It also helps to control excess oil production, which can contribute to acne development.

5. Enhances Product Penetration

After exfoliating, your skin is better prepared to absorb the active ingredients in your skincare products. This means that your moisturizers, serums, and other treatments can penetrate deeper and work more effectively.

Methods of Exfoliation

There are various methods of exfoliation, and it is essential to choose the right one for your skin type and concerns. Here are some popular methods:.

1. Physical Exfoliation

Physical exfoliation involves using a scrub or tool to physically remove dead skin cells. This can be done using a gentle facial scrub, a brush, or a scrubbing tool.

It is important to be gentle during physical exfoliation to avoid irritating or damaging your skin.

2. Chemical Exfoliation

Chemical exfoliation involves using acids or enzymes to dissolve dead skin cells. Common chemical exfoliants include alpha-hydroxy acids (AHAs) such as glycolic acid and lactic acid, and beta-hydroxy acids (BHAs) such as salicylic acid.

These exfoliants are available in different concentrations and formulations, and they work by dissolving the bonds that hold dead skin cells together.

3. Enzyme Exfoliation

Enzyme exfoliation utilizes natural enzymes, typically derived from fruits like papaya and pineapple, to break down dead skin cells.

This method is especially suitable for sensitive skin types as it provides a gentler exfoliation compared to physical or chemical methods.

Tips for Effective Exfoliation

To get the most out of your exfoliation routine and achieve velvety smooth skin, consider the following tips:.

1. Choose the Right Exfoliant for Your Skin Type

Every skin type is different, so it’s important to choose an exfoliant that suits your specific needs. If you have sensitive skin, opt for a gentler exfoliant like enzyme-based products.

If you have oily or acne-prone skin, a chemical exfoliant with salicylic acid can be effective.

2. Exfoliate Regularly, but Don’t Overdo It

Exfoliating two to three times a week is generally sufficient for most skin types. Over-exfoliating can strip away the natural oils and protective barrier of your skin, leading to dryness, irritation, and even breakouts.

3. Be Gentle During Exfoliation

Regardless of the exfoliation method you use, always be gentle to avoid causing damage to your skin. Avoid aggressive scrubbing or applying too much pressure. Let the exfoliant do the work.

4. Follow with Moisturizer

After exfoliating, it is essential to moisturize your skin to replenish hydration and nourishment. Choose a moisturizer suitable for your skin type to keep your skin plump and healthy.

5. Protect Your Skin from the Sun

Exfoliation can make your skin more sensitive to the sun’s harmful rays. Be sure to apply a broad-spectrum sunscreen with a sufficient SPF to protect your skin from damage.
